Abstract

Disclosed in the utility model is a telecommunication equipment room monitoring system that comprises a remote monitoring center. An access control unit with an identification function is arranged on a door of a telecommunication equipment room; a power supply grid and a storage battery are connected with the equipment in the telecommunication equipment room; a power supply monitoring unit and a power supply switching unit are arranged inside the telecommunication equipment room; the power supply monitoring unit and the power supply switching unit are connected with the power supply grid and the storage battery; and the power supply monitoring unit and the power supply switching unit are connected with the remote monitoring center by a wireless communication network. According to the monitoring system, security, reliability and normal operation of the telecommunication equipment can be ensured.

Background technology
Telecommunications room is the pith of communication network, and society belongs to the information age of high speed development, and the stability of communication system has very important meaning to people's work and life.If communication system breaks down, cause communication disruption or Quality Down, then tend to cause very large inconvenience to the user, even cause huge loss.A lot of telecommunication apparatus are owing to the reason in geographical position all is unattended, when because the reason of artificial or natural conditions causes the damage of facilities in the telecommunications room, until communication system has broken down or after a period of time of paralysing, network management center just finds, can't really guarantee the safe and reliable of telecommunication apparatus and normal operation.
The utility model content
Technical problem to be solved in the utility model is: a kind of telecommunications room supervisory control system is provided, guarantees the safe and reliable and normal operation of telecommunication apparatus.
For solving the problems of the technologies described above, the technical solution of the utility model is: the telecommunications room supervisory control system, comprise remote monitoring center, described telecommunications room door is provided with the gate inhibition unit with identity recognition function, equipment connection in the described telecommunications room has power supply grid and storage battery, be provided with power supply monitoring unit and power switching unit in the described telecommunications room, described power supply monitoring unit all has described power supply grid to be connected with storage battery with the power switching unit, described gate inhibition unit, power supply monitoring unit and power switching unit all are connected by wireless communication networks with described remote monitoring center.
Preferably, be provided with temperature and humidity monitor unit and temperature and humidity regulation unit in the described telecommunications room, described temperature and humidity monitor unit and temperature and humidity regulation unit all are connected by wireless communication networks with described remote monitoring center.
Preferably, described temperature and humidity regulation unit comprises blower fan and the heater that is arranged in the described telecommunications room.
Preferably, be provided with the video monitoring unit in the described telecommunications room, described video monitoring unit is connected by wireless communication networks with described remote monitoring center.
Preferably, the camera of described video monitoring unit is arranged at respectively a plurality of positions of the inner and telecommunications room outside of described telecommunications room.
Adopted technique scheme, the beneficial effects of the utility model are: because the telecommunications room supervisory control system comprises gate inhibition unit, power supply monitoring unit and power switching unit, therefore only have the remote monitoring center mandate or just can enter telecommunications room by access card, prevent that effectively the lawless person from entering machine room equipment is damaged, greatly improve the fail safe of telecommunications room; In addition, when the power supply monitoring unit inspection during without electricity, passes to power switching unit with signal to power supply grid, make storage battery carry out work, thereby guarantee the normal operation of telecommunication apparatus.
Owing to being provided with temperature and humidity monitor unit and temperature and humidity regulation unit in the telecommunications room, temperature and humidity monitor unit and temperature and humidity regulation unit all are connected by wireless communication networks with remote monitoring center, therefore can monitor and regulate the weather conditions of telecommunications room by remote monitoring center, telecommunications room is in the best effort environment all the time, thereby effectively reduces failure rate.
Owing to being provided with the video monitoring unit in the telecommunications room, conveniently illegal operation being monitored.
